There isn't a single average cost to put in a tankless water heater, as it depends on the unit's features and your home's existing infrastructure. Factors like gas line capacity and venting needs are significant considerations. We'll explain these variables when we provide your free estimate.

DIY installation of a tankless water heater is complex and requires specialized knowledge to ensure safety and efficiency. Improper installation can lead to performance issues or hazards. For a reliable and efficient upgrade in your Lafayette home, professional installation is strongly recommended.
